Rolex Accuracy Chart: Decoding the Specifications

Unlike quartz watches which boast incredibly high accuracy, mechanical watches, including Rolex automatics, are inherently less precise. Their accuracy is determined by a complex interplay of mechanical components, lubrication, and the wearer's activity. There isn't a publicly available, comprehensive "Rolex Accuracy Chart" detailing the performance of each individual model across its lifespan. Rolex's official stance is less about precise numerical tolerances and more about meeting a general standard of accuracy within a specified range.

While Rolex doesn't publish a detailed chart, the generally accepted tolerance for a Rolex watch, following COSC certification (Contrôle Officiel Suisse des Chronomètres), is -2/+2 seconds per day. This means that a COSC-certified Rolex should lose no more than two seconds or gain no more than two seconds in a 24-hour period. It's crucial to understand that this is a *theoretical* ideal, achieved under controlled laboratory conditions. Real-world performance can vary significantly.

Rolex Accuracy Per Month: The Cumulative Effect

Extrapolating the daily tolerance, a COSC-certified Rolex could theoretically lose or gain up to ±60 seconds per month (-2/+2 seconds/day * 30 days). However, this is a simplification. Factors such as temperature fluctuations, the watch's position (worn on the wrist vs. stationary), and the level of winding can all impact the monthly accuracy. Some owners report significantly better or worse performance than the theoretical ±60 seconds per month.

How Accurate Are Rolex Automatics?

Rolex automatics, like all mechanical watches, are susceptible to variations in accuracy. While many aim for the COSC standard of -2/+2 seconds per day, this is not a guaranteed performance metric. The accuracy of a Rolex automatic depends on several factors:

* Movement Type: Different Rolex calibers have different performance characteristics. Some movements are known for their robustness and reliability, while others might exhibit greater variation in accuracy.

* Maintenance: Regular servicing by a certified Rolex technician is crucial for maintaining optimal accuracy. Lubrication, cleaning, and adjustment of the movement components are essential for consistent performance.

* Wear and Tear: Over time, wear and tear on the movement's components can affect accuracy.

* Environmental Factors: Temperature changes, magnetic fields, and shocks can all impact the performance of a mechanical movement.
